Acerca de SGBD Oracle, Postgres e MySQL, julgue os próximos itens.
Considerando um layout de instalação do MySQL em uma distribuição binária, o aplicativo para controle do servidor é instalado no diretório /usr/local/mysql/Bin.
A respeito de PL/SQL, julgue os itens a seguir.
Um bloco de programa PL/SQL inclui partes bem distintas, como declaração (declaration) de variáveis e objetos, módulo executável (executable) e módulo de excessões (exception).
Julgue os itens seguintes acerca de DML (data manipulation language) e DDL (data definition language).
Geralmente, o sistema de banco de dados disponibiliza uma linguagem que é, na realidade, uma combinação de pelo menos duas linguagens subordinadas, uma DDL e uma DML.
Julgue os itens seguintes acerca de DML (data manipulation language) e DDL (data definition language).
As DML devem ser utilizadas incorporadas a outras linguagens, chamadas de linguagens hospedeiras, uma vez que sentenças escritas em DML devem estar embutidas em código escrito em uma linguagem hospedeira para que possam ser executadas.
Julgue os itens a seguir acerca de técnicas de análise de desempenho e otimização de consultas SQL em banco de dados.
O processo de otimização de consultas SQL aumenta o throughput do sistema e permite diminuir a contenção, fazendo que, no mesmo intervalo de tempo, necessariamente, seja requerida a execução de maior workload que na situação sem otimização.
A respeito de PL/SQL, julgue os itens a seguir.
O trecho de programa em PL/SQL a seguir possibilita remover os efeitos de determinada transação no banco de dado, sempre que um erro ocorrer durante a execução.
EXCEPTION
WHEN OTHERS THEN
dbms_output.put_line ( Erro na
atualização do Salário )
ROLLBACK
Julgue os itens a seguir acerca de técnicas de análise de desempenho e otimização de consultas SQL em banco de dados.
Na fase de projeto, considera-se o volume esperado de dados em cada relação e quais consultas serão realizadas com mais frequência como indicadores para prever o desempenho do banco de dados.
Acerca de SGBD Oracle, Postgres e MySQL, julgue os próximos itens.
Os componentes de uma data block (menor unidade de entrada/saída) em um banco de dados Oracle são: header, table directory, row directory, row data e free space.
Julgue os itens seguintes acerca de DML (data manipulation language) e DDL (data definition language).
A criação de visões em um banco de dados relacional pode ser feita por meio de sentenças escritas em uma DDL.
Julgue os itens seguintes acerca de DML (data manipulation language) e DDL (data definition language).
Os esquemas externo e conceitual de um banco de dados podem ser definidos utilizando-se uma DDL. Contudo, para se definir o esquema interno, é preciso que se utilize outro tipo de linguagem.
A respeito de PL/SQL, julgue os itens a seguir.
O trecho de programa em PL/SQL a seguir possibilita aumentar o valor da variável salary em 15%, sempre que esta alcançar valor abaixo da variável media_salary. UPDATE servidor
SET salary = salary*1.1
WHERE salary < media_salary
Acerca de SGBD Oracle, Postgres e MySQL, julgue os próximos itens.
Entre as formas de se programar em Oracle, estão a utilização de SQL interativo, de host languages (C, Pascal, Cobol com SQL embedded), de PL/SQL, de Oracle Call Interface (OCI) e de Oracle runtime library (SQLLIB).
Julgue os itens a seguir acerca de técnicas de análise de desempenho e otimização de consultas SQL em banco de dados.
As técnicas de otimização embasadas em heurísticas permitem estimar, sistematicamente, o custo de estratégias de execução diferentes e escolher o plano de execução com o menor custo estimado.